SAS接口
电脑集线技术
串行SCSISAS:Serial Attached SCSI)是一种电脑集线的技术,其功能主要是做周边零件的数据传输,如:硬盘CD-ROM等设备而设计的接口。串行SCSI 由并行SCSI物理存储接口演化而来,是由ANSI INCITS T10技术委员会(T10 committee)开发及维护的新的存储接口标准。与并行方式相比,串行方式能提供更快速的通信传输速度以及更简易的配置。此外SAS并支持与串行式ATASATA)设备兼容,且两者可以使用相类似的电缆。
SAS简介
存储领域的磁盘介质是最关键的设备,所有数据和信息都要存放在磁盘介质上。而数据的读取速度则是由磁盘介质的连接接口决定的。以往我们都是通过SCSI或者SATA接口及硬盘来完成数据存储工作。正因为SATA技术的飞速发展以及多方面的优势,才会让更多的人考虑能否存在一种方式可以将SATA与SCSI两者相结合,这样就可以同时发挥两者的优势了。在这种情况下SAS应运而生。
技术分析
SAS由3种类型协议组成,根据连接的不同设备使用相应的协议进行数据传输。
1.串行SCSI协议 (SSP) —用于和SCSI设备沟通。
2.串行ATA通道协议 (STP) —用于和SATA设备沟通。
3.SCSI管理协议 (SMP) —用于对SAS设备的维护和管理。
第一代SAS为数组中的每个驱动器提供 3.0 Gbps(3000 Mbps)的传输速率
第二代SAS为数组中的每个驱动器提供 6.0 Gbps(6000 Mbps)的传输速率。
SAS的接口技术可以向下兼容SATA。SAS系统的背板(Backplane)既可以连接具有双端口、高性能的SAS驱动器,也可以连接高容量、低成本的SATA驱动器。因为SAS驱动器的端口与SATA驱动器的端口形状看上去类似,所以SAS驱动器和SATA驱动器可以同时存在于一个存储系统之中。但需要注意的是,SATA系统并不兼容SAS,所以SAS驱动器不能连接到SATA背板上。由于SAS系统的兼容性,IT人员能够运用不同接口的硬盘来满足各类应用在容量上或效能上的需求,因此在扩充存储系统时拥有更多的弹性,让存储设备发挥最大的投资效益。说白了SAS接口技术就是使用串行接口的SCSI硬盘,他和SATA硬盘是兼容的,我们可以在SAS接口上安装SAS硬盘或者SATA硬盘。
SAS接口比普通SCSI接口小很多,并支持2.5英寸的硬盘。SAS采取直接的点对点序列式传输方式,传输速率最高可达3Gbps。
根据使用环境的不同,sas连接器与线缆分为外部链接器和内部连接器两种。外部连接器支持4个物理连接(16根数据线),线缆的物理连接数目则在1 w-4个之间;内部连接器支持2个物理连接(双端口),巧针电源接口也做在一起(共29针),线缆的物理连接数目为1个或2个(双端口)。背板作为一种特殊的内部连接方式,支持2个物理连接(双端口)并提供电源接口。各种连接器和背板规范由SFF协会(Small Form Factor Committee, SFF)制定。
内部链接器上的端口与并行SCSI有很大区别,跟SATA磁盘的端口兼容。SAS磁盘与SATA磁盘接口的唯一区别是SAS磁盘还有第二个冗余端口,而SATA磁盘则只有一个端口。SAS的数据帧基于FCP,并在外围设备端添加了第二端口支持,形成符合高可用性要求的双端口(Dual Port)一一这一点也类似于FC。
产品特点
网络存储设备大致可分为三大类,即高端中端和近端(Near-Line)。高端存储设备主要是光纤通道为主,由于光纤通道传输速度很快,所以高端存储光纤设备大部分应用于任务级关键数据的大容量实时存储上。中端存储设备主要是SCSI设备,他的历史也很悠久,应用于商业级的关键数据的大容量存储。缩写为(SATA),应用于非关键数据的大容量存储,目的是替代以前使用磁带的数据备份
光纤通道存储设备的最大优势就是传输速度快,但是他的价格很高,维护起来也相对麻烦;而SCSI设备存取速度相对比较快,价格位于中等位置,但是他的扩展性稍微差一点,每个SCSI接口卡最多只能连接15个(单通道)或者30个(双通道)设备。SATA则是飞速发展的技术,他的最大优势就是价格便宜,而且速度并不比SCSI接口慢多少,随着技术的发展SATA的数据读取速度正在接近并赶超SCSI接口。另外由于SATA的硬盘价格越来越低,容量越来越大,逐渐可以用于数据备份。
因此传统的企业级存储由于考虑到性能和稳定性,以SCSI硬盘和光纤通道为主要存储平台,SATA则多用于非关键性资料或桌面个人计算机上,不过随着SATA技术的兴起与SATA设备的成熟,这个模式正在被改变,越来越多的人都开始关注SATA这种串行数据存储连接方式
成本
以往不管使用SCSI接口还是FC光纤接口,当一个厂商生产磁盘阵列柜时需要的技术是非常高的,成本也很高,可以通过共用组件降低设计成本。这样就可以花更少的钱享受SCSI接口的性能。
提高
串行SCSI是点到点的结构,可以建立磁盘到控制器的直接连接。通过点到点技术可以减少了地址冲突以及菊花链连结的减速,为每个设备提供了专用的信号通路来保证最大的带宽,并且每个传输通道都是在全双工方式下进行的。总的说来他的性能要比传统SCSI更高。
性能
上面笔者也提到了SCSI接口的扩展性能一般,最多只能连接15个(单通道)或者30个(双通道)设备。而经过改良后的SAS接口则大大不同,SAS结构有非常好的扩展能力,最多可以连接16384个磁盘设备。
简单
SAS接口使用更细的电缆搭配更小的连接器,一方面节约了服务器或存储设备的空间,另一方节省了空间,从而提高了使用SAS硬盘服务器的散热、通风能力。而传统的SCSI接口使用较大的并行电缆,这会带来部分电子干扰,采用SAS的电缆结构就不会出现此问题。另外每个SAS电缆有四根电缆,两根输入两根输出。SAS可以同时进行数据的读写,全双工数据操作提高数据的吞吐效率。
性高
正如上文所说我们在SAS接口卡上安装SATA设备也是可以正常工作的,这样就让我们的存储系统应用更加灵活,可以根据实际需求选择SAS磁盘或者SATA磁盘,降低了成本的同时也保证了性能。对于对数据读取速度要求不高的地方可以使用SATA设备替代SAS设备。
总的来说SAS技术是结合了SATA与SCSI两者的优点而诞生的,同时串行SCSI(SAS)是点到点的结构,因此除了提高性能之外,每个设备连接到指定的数据通路上提高了带宽,从而为数据传输与存取提供了必要保障。
参考资料
最新修订时间:2024-04-10 15:57
目录
概述
SAS简介
技术分析
参考资料